A Different Kind of RAC Role: Welcome to SMR

The RAC is renowned for roadside rescue, but our SMR division is all about structured, planned repairs and servicing—right at our members' locations. Say goodbye to emergency callouts and unpredictable shifts!

What to Expect

Your day will kick off with a clear digital schedule, allowing you to:

  • Perform routine servicing
  • Utilize advanced mobile diagnostics
  • Conduct in-depth repairs typically done in a workshop
  • Provide valuable advice and recommendations to members
  • Carry out vehicle safety checks aligned with RAC standards

With everything you need from day one—a fully equipped RAC van, fuel card, uniform, and tools—you’ll be set to deliver quality service with confidence.

What You’ll Need

  • Level 2 qualification in Light Vehicle Maintenance (or equivalent)
  • Minimum of 2 years’ experience as a vehicle technician working on light vehicles
  • A full UK driving licence with fewer than 6 points
